EDITOR’S NOTE<br />

To all our readers, advertisers and friends, I greet you as the new editor of<br />

MzanziTravel and hope to build on the sterling work of my predecessor and our<br />

entire very dedicated and fantastic team.<br />

It has been a sheer pleasure and exciting journey producing this, our 3rd edition and my<br />

first. MzanziTravel is certainly establishing itself as the premier publication for both foreign<br />

and local domestic tourists in South Africa, covering every tourism niche. One of our key<br />

aims is to open up the immense tourism potential of South Africa to its own citizens and<br />

inspire local travel. An entire universe of experiences and delights are to be found right<br />

here within our borders.<br />

In our new regular feature called Hidden Gems, we explore those fascinating and often<br />

little-known places off the beaten track, to be discovered all over South Africa. But we don’t<br />

stop at the border; we also explore the rest of Africa in all its wonderful variety in each<br />

edition. This time we focus on that ancient and fascinating land, Ethiopia, while we also take<br />

you on an adventurous Namibian love affair.<br />

In this edition we also visit the beautiful iSimangaliso Wetland Park, South Africa’s first<br />

UNESCO World Heritage Site; explore the cultural and natural diversity of life along the<br />

banks of the Olifants River; focus on KwaZulu-Natal, land of the Zulu Kingdom, icons,<br />

legends and battlefields; we step back in time and rediscover the coast and South Africa’s<br />

historic lighthouses; experience the creative Karoo spectacle of AfrikaBurn; and submerge<br />

ourselves into the urban hustle and bustle of Johannesburg’s innovative Maboneng<br />

Precinct.<br />
